Royal baby: Kate gives birth to boy

Duchess of Cambridge

The Duchess of Cambridge has given birth to a baby boy, Kensington Palace has announced.

The baby was delivered at 16:24 at St Mary’s Hospital in Paddington, west London, weighing 8lb 6oz (= 3,8 kg).

The palace said in a statement that the duchess and the baby were “doing well” and would stay in hospital overnight.

The press release said the Duke of Cambridge (the father of the baby) was present for the birth.

Prime Minister David Cameron said on Twitter: “I’m delighted for the Duke and Duchess now their son has been born. The whole country will celebrate. They’ll make wonderful parents.”

March 21st : International Day for the Elimination of Racial Discrimination

The United Nations’ (UN) International Day for the Elimination of Racial Discrimination is observed with a series of events and activities all around the world on March 21 each year. The day aims to remind people of racial discrimination’s negative consequences. It also encourages people to remember their obligation and determination to fight racial discrimination.

Secret Santa

Travelbug Secret Santa

The “Secret Santa” game is played in December. Each player picks up a name in a hat or ion a box, and keeps the name secret. They must buy a present or do small acts of kindness to this person for the whole Christmas season. At Christmas, the secret is revealed.
